Abstract

The embodiment of the present invention discloses an interior design method and system based on user interest preference, the method includes: the designer edits and designs the 3D design plan for the interior design, and associates the 3D design plan with the 2D rendering of the interior design Upload to the server; the user sets the initial preference, and the server automatically recommends the interior design 2D rendering to the user's mobile terminal according to the user's preference; the user clicks on the interior design 2D rendering to automatically obtain the display effect of the 3D design scheme; the user uploads the interested picture to obtain the interest The 2D renderings associated with the pictures and the corresponding 3D design schemes; users communicate with designers and exchange 3D design schemes online. The invention simultaneously investigates user attributes, browsed content attributes, and user operation behaviors in the system, effectively understands user preferences, realizes automatic recommendation of design schemes, and enables users and designers to participate in scheme design online at the same time, reducing communication costs , Improving the communication efficiency between designers and customers.

technical field [0001] The invention relates to the technical field of interior design, in particular to an interior design method and system based on user interest preference. Background technique [0002] The interior design industry is an industry with strong verticality and a high proportion of personalized services. On the one hand, professional designers need to capture the needs of customers and grasp targeted design solutions; on the other hand, non-professional customers do not have professional design Under the guidance of knowledge, ability, and expert opinions, there are greater difficulties in intuitively expressing needs, communicating, and improving design associations. Existing interior design systems do not recommend design solutions based on user interests, nor allow non-professional designers and home improvement users to participate in the design by themselves, so it is difficult to find user preferences and give them satisfactory design solutions.
